Tour overview
Experience the beauty and heritage of the Sea of Japan coast on this full-day guided excursion, starting either in Kyoto or Osaka. Board a comfortable air-conditioned vehicle and set off toward the stunning landscapes and cultural icons of the Kyoto Coast region, with support from a professional multilingual guide in English, Japanese or Chinese.
Marvel at the Amanohashidate Sandbar
Your route begins at Amanohashidate, a natural sandbar that stretches across scenic Miyazu Bay. Dubbed 'Heaven's Bridge' for its transcendental views, the sandbar is lined with lush pine trees and white beaches. You may even try the cable car (extra charge) up to Mt Monju for a panoramic look, where the sandbar is said to resemble a flying dragon from above.
Visit Chionji Temple
Next, explore the tranquil Chionji Temple, one of the region's most famous Buddhist temples. Known locally as Bussharado, the temple is easily identified by its impressive Sanmon Gate, the largest of its kind in the region. At Chionji, try your luck with the unique fan-shaped 'omikuji' fortunes that represent hopes for self-improvement and academic success.
Soak in Amanohashidate’s Hot Springs
Take a moment to refresh at the local open-air hot springs. The soothing waters offer the chance to relax your body and mind while soaking up views of the bay.
Explore Ine: The Venice of Japan
Continue on to the quaint fishing village of Ine, famed for its charming 'funaya' – traditional wooden boathouses built above the water’s edge. Walk or cycle between these unique dwellings, observe local life, and discover why Ine is called the Venice of Japan. Enjoy the option of a boat ride on the bay, often accompanied by seagull feeding for a fun extra experience.
